Loss and Wonder at the World's End Laura A. Ogden
Loss and Wonder at the World's End
Laura A. Ogden
Laura A. Ogden considers a wide range of people, animal, and objects together as a way to catalog the ways environmental change and colonial history are entangled in the Fuegian Archipelago of southernmost Chile and Argentina.
